Output 821173d87242a9d8d41f92f7339471661a29fc508b7221f5e21bcdcfff7fa671:3

value
2674052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af337fa754d01bff31d139f5fd5cd4d572d15f0a OP_EQUAL
address
3HfPsJWt1jm2Svc2kJ3fGsQipuwRyt7Ad8
transaction
821173d87242a9d8d41f92f7339471661a29fc508b7221f5e21bcdcfff7fa671
spent
true